Pelvic cardiovascular magnetic resonance venography: venous changes with patient position and hydration status.

Common femoral and common/external iliac vein size on CMR venography may be affected by position and hydration status. Routine clinical CMR venography of the pelvis could include prone positioning and avoiding dehydration to maximize pelvic vein distension.
